First, there was a written test to check my writing, grammar, and editing abilities. Then, I had a face-to-face interview with the team lead and the HOD. They were both friendly and asked about my past work, how I manage multiple projects, and how I'd respond to criticism. Although I felt the interview went well, I never heard back, and they didn't respond to my follow-up email.
The interview process involved a written test first, and then interviews with the managers and HODs. The written test is to check your language skills. The interviews are to check your personality. The grammar test is not very hard, but focus on tenses, subject verb agreement, spelling, and other grammar points.
The interview process wasn't really structured or focused on job-related questions. The way they handled things felt unprofessional and could've been smoother, especially since the company has a pretty good reputation.
